Other Mental and Social Health Services and Allied Professions Schools in Nebraska
4 students earned Other Mental and Social Health Services and Allied Professions degrees in Nebraska in the 2022-2023 year.
In terms of popularity, Other Mental and Social Health Services and Allied Professions is the 358th most popular major in the state out of a total 532 majors commonly available.
